Endovascular Management of Epistaxis Secondary to Dissecting Pseudoaneurysm of the Descending Palatine Artery Following Orthognathic Surgery

Orthognathic surgeries such as Le Fort I are widely used in clinical practice. Postoperative internal maxillary artery pseudoaneurysm is a very rare complication, which can lead to significant postoperative bleeding. In this article, we report a case of early postoperative bleeding secondary to pseudoaneurysm following
Le Fort I surgery with a novel endovascular treatment approach.
